Transaction 75452b979b5ad7af31c91d734cc21535177d07a1b8fd7f63c2a012cff4067d5f
1 Input
2 Outputs
- 75452b979b5ad7af31c91d734cc21535177d07a1b8fd7f63c2a012cff4067d5f:0
- 75452b979b5ad7af31c91d734cc21535177d07a1b8fd7f63c2a012cff4067d5f:1
value 27828
address 1A6rC5xL96REhzkSL7caJCdSeJEf5BHPwk
value 294463
address 3Qbg64jcC4LZk8n1xk8sHhUTVtvk9H3XFW